IT’S the latest sign of leveraged mania hitting bondholders: Companies across Europe are piling on debt at the fastest pace in years to enrich their private-equity owners.

The controversial practice known as dividend recaps is growing as investors gorge on every credit risk while sponsors extract income as they await the economic rebound.

“If people want to put capital to work they’re just buying anything with a bit of yield, regardless of what proceeds are for, ” said Mark Benbow, a high-yield fund manager at Aegon Asset Management. “Hold your nose and harvest income.”
